Michael Jackson, the legendary King of Pop, was not only known for his groundbreaking music but also for his iconic homes. These residences were more than just places to live; they were extensions of his persona and career.
| Aspect | Details |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Personal Residences | 1. Neverland Ranch (Sycamore Valley Ranch), California: 12,600 sq ft mansion, 5 bedrooms, 8 bathrooms, private amusement park on 2700 acres. Owned 1988-2009. Sold in 2020 for $22M to Ron Burkle. 2. Las Vegas Mansion at 2785 S. Monte Cristo Way: 10 bedrooms, 7 full baths, 3 partial baths on 1-acre lot; rented from 2006-2008, paid $50,000/month rent. 3. “Thriller Villa” in Las Vegas: Spanish-style mansion with 10 bedrooms, chapel, bars, and other luxury amenities; rented 2007-2009. 4. Holmby Hills, Los Angeles mansion: 7 bedrooms, 13 bathrooms, 12 fireplaces; last home before death; rented by AEG. |
Neverland was a private amusement estate. Las Vegas homes rented, not owned. Holmby Hills mansion sold after his death. |
| Current Residence | Michael Jackson passed away in 2009. His daughter Paris Jackson reportedly lives alone in a mansion in Encino, Los Angeles, associated with the family estate. | Michael Jackson himself does not currently live (deceased). |
| Net Worth at Death | Negative $500 million debt at the time of death in 2009, primarily due to lawsuits and expenses. | Later, his estate’s value recovered significantly posthumously. |
| Estate Value Now | Estimated worth of $768 million AUD as of 2025, with the estate earning from royalties and assets. | Includes music rights, properties, and other assets. |

Background on Michael Jackson’s Homes

The Journey of Michael Jackson’s Residences
Throughout his life, Michael Jackson called several places home. From his humble beginnings in Gary, Indiana, to the iconic Neverland Ranch, each residence had its own unique story and significance.
- Gary, Indiana: Michael Jackson’s childhood home, where he began his musical journey with his brothers in the Jackson 5.
- Encino, California: The Jackson family’s home in the San Fernando Valley, where Michael spent his teenage years and early adulthood.
- Neverland Ranch: The famous estate in Santa Barbara County, California, where Michael created a magical world for himself and his guests.
- Holmby Hills, Los Angeles: A luxurious mansion that Michael rented in the early 2000s.
- Beverly Hills, Los Angeles: The final home Michael Jackson lived in, which we’ll explore in detail in this article.

| Aspect | Details |
|---|---|
| Property Name | Neverland Ranch (later renamed Sycamore Valley Ranch) |
| Location/Address | Santa Barbara County, California, near Los Olivos, approx. 5 miles north of Los Olivos, CA |
| Original Name | Sycamore Valley Ranch (before Michael Jackson’s purchase) |
| Purchased By Michael Jackson | 1988 |
| Purchase Price | Approx. $19.5 million (some sources suggest up to $30 million) |
| Property Size | Approximately 2,700 acres |
| Main House Size | About 12,000 to 13,000 square feet |
| Bedrooms | 6 bedrooms |
| Architectural Style | Tudor-style with Hollywood Tudor influences, designed originally by architect Robert Altevers |
| Year Main House Built | 1981-1982 (by developer William Bone) |
| Additional Features | Movie theater (~5,500 sq ft), guest houses, large swimming pool with cabana, basketball court, train station with working train, amusement park rides (Ferris wheel, carousel, roller coaster, etc.), formal gardens, lakes, waterfalls |
| Animals | Home to giraffes, elephants, orangutans, birds, reptiles during Michael Jackson’s residence |
| Design Intent | A personal fantasy land inspired by Peter Pan, designed as a private amusement park and home to bring joy and innocence, especially to children |
| Property Market History | Listed for sale multiple times since 2015, initially at $100 million, price reduced to $67 million, then to $31 million; sold in 2020 for $22 million to businessman Ronald Burkle |
